3D Systems (DDD) Misses Q2 EPS by 4c; Reaffirms Outlook
July 30, 2013 8:01 AM EDT(Updated - July 30, 2013 8:09 AM EDT)
3D Systems (NYSE: DDD) reported Q2 EPS of $0.20, $0.04 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.24. Revenue for the quarter came in at $120.5 million versus the consensus estimate of $114.63 million.
